Nymphenburg Palace Park: A Baroque Masterpiece

The tour begins with a 30-minute walk through Nymphenburg Palace Park, a large 700-hectare landscape famed for its elegant architecture and carefully designed gardens. As one of Europe’s most significant baroque parks, it offers picturesque views, sculptures, and waterways. This walk provides a chance to appreciate the peaceful atmosphere and grand design of the palace and its surroundings.

Olympiapark and BMW Welt: A Futuristic Contrast

Next, the Olympic Park is a large green space that served as the venue for the 1972 Olympic Games. Visitors can expect to see iconic structures like the Olympic Tower and stadiums, which remain impressive examples of 20th-century architecture. During the approximately one-hour free time, guests can relax, stroll, or explore further on their own.

Adjacent to Olympiapark, BMW Welt offers an exciting glimpse into the world of luxury cars. Visitors encounter spectacular vehicle displays from BMW, Mini, and Rolls-Royce. This stop combines visual spectacle with the opportunity to explore the latest in automotive innovation, making it a highlight for car enthusiasts and casual visitors alike.

The Charm of Haidhausen and Wiener Platz

The final segment of the tour takes you into Haidhausen, known for its lively streets, boutique shops, and cafes. Wiener Platz, the historic marketplace since 1889, hosts one of Munich’s four permanent markets. The Maypole in the square is a notable feature, along with the Hofbräukeller, one of Europe’s largest beer gardens.
